    Synopsis

    Do you love to take photographs? Do you tote your camera wherever you go? Now you can realize your dream of working from your home at something you'd enjoy - a home-based photography business.

    Author Kenn Oberrecht shares his experiences and down-to-earth advice on every aspect of setting up and running a thriving home-based photography business, from estimating your start-up costs and outfitting your darkroom to staying profitable once you're in business. Use his handy worksheets, quizzes, and checklists as practical steps toward achieving your dream.

    Whether you want to earn your living as a portrait photographer, photojournalist, or product photographer - or be the most versatile photographer in your community - this guide will put you on the path to building your own home-based business. Learn all about honing your photography skills, working out of your home, buying the right computer equipment, pricing your services, getting paid and marketing your business on the Web.

    Biography

    Kenn Oberrecht is the author of over two dozen books, and has written for such magazines as Modern Photography, Sports Illustrated, and The Writer. He has taught both photography and writing at the university level, and is currently a freelance photographer and writer working out of his home in Oregon.
